Just this morning had a customer bring in an OLD generator that had been under water. It is a Tecumseh with points. I cleaned the water from the tank, the sediment bowl, and took the carb apart and blew out all the water, filed the points and of course cleaned the water out. Changed the oil, and it runs great. Put lots of Iso-heat in the new gas.
